Understanding subtraction for children aged 7-9 is crucial for several reasons. Firstly, subtraction is one of the basic building blocks of mathematics, an integral part of daily life and many future academic pursuits. When parents and teachers invest time in ensuring children grasp this concept, they lay a strong foundation for more complex mathematical operations such as multiplication, division, and algebra.

Secondly, proficiency in subtraction enhances problem-solving and critical-thinking skills. At this age, children are naturally curious and learning to subtract helps them to understand not only how to take numbers away but also how to compare quantities and make decisions based on those comparisons.

Furthermore, mastering subtraction through practical examples, such as counting change or determining the remaining time for an activity, helps children relate more intimately with their environment. It nurtures confidence and independence, as they are able to handle mathematical challenges that arise in daily life.

Lastly, an early understanding of subtraction promotes a positive attitude towards mathematics. When children repeatedly succeed in grasping mathematical concepts, they are more likely to enjoy and excel in the subject, reducing anxiety and fostering a lifelong appreciation.

In summary, understanding subtraction fosters fundamental mathematical skills, enhances problem-solving abilities, supports practical learning, and promotes a positive math attitude, making it vital for children’s overall educational development.
